On Tuesday Alberta’s chief medical officer of health, Dr. Deena Hinshaw announced that part of the back-to-school rules amid the COVID-19 pandemic will require Grade 4-12 students and teachers to wear masks in hallways and common areas at all times. Hinshaw clarified that masks will be optional inside the classroom as long as students are appropriately spaced apart.
